Adoyeva () is a rural locality () in Dyakonovsky Selsoviet Rural Settlement, Oktyabrsky District, Kursk Oblast, Russia. Population:

== Geography == The village is located on the Vorobzha River (a left tributary of the Seym River), 69 km from the Russia–Ukraine border, 19 km south-west of Kursk, 4 km south-west of the district center – the urban-type settlement Pryamitsyno, 0.5 km from the selsoviet center – Dyakonovo. Climate Adoyeva has a warm-summer humid continental climate (Dfb in the Köppen climate classification).
